Why do consumers need to know about SUV rollovers?
SUVs have a higher center of gravity, making them more prone to rollovers during sharp maneuvers, high speeds, or when overloaded. Knowing the risks helps you drive defensively, load and maintain the vehicle correctly, and choose safer models.

Are SUV the only vehicles that roll over?
No. Any vehicle can roll over under the wrong conditions, though taller vehicles like SUVs, pickups, and vans are generally more prone than low-slung cars.

Why Are So Few Grade Crossings Protected By Flashers And/Or Gates?
Upgrades are prioritized using risk and traffic studies and depend on funding shared by railroads and public agencies. Many crossings remain passive (signs only), and some are private or low-volume, delaying installation of active protection.
-
What Are The Railroad's Responsibilities In The Area Of Providing Grade Crossing Protection?
Comply with federal/state safety standards, maintain tracks, crossing surfaces, and any railroad-owned signals, respond to malfunctions, and reasonably warn of known hazards while coordinating with road authorities on needed improvements.

If I am a driver of a vehicle that is involved in a bus collision, whom can I sue?
The bus driver/company or transit authority, negligent third-party drivers, maintenance contractors, and occasionally product manufacturers for defects - subject to comparative fault and any government immunities.
-
Do I need an attorney to bring a case involving a bus accident?
Strongly recommended. Bus cases often involve multiple defendants, government procedures, video/telematics, and complex insurance layers; early evidence preservation is key.
-
If I am a pedestrian hit by a bus or a loved one was killed by a bus while walking or waiting for a bus, whom can I bring a case against?
Potential defendants include the bus driver, the bus company or transit authority, maintenance contractors, other negligent motorists, and sometimes a city for dangerous conditions (public-entity notice rules may apply).
